Market Overview - The market opened high and fluctuated throughout the day, with the Shanghai Composite Index returning above 3200 points, and both the Shenzhen Component and ChiNext Index rising over 2% [1] - The consumer sector showed strong performance, particularly in dairy and retail, while the concept of a unified market continued to gain momentum [1] - The overall market saw nearly 5000 stocks in the green, with a total trading volume of 1.66 trillion [1] Key Highlights 1. Belt and Road Initiative and Ports - The Belt and Road, port, and logistics sectors continued their strong performance from the previous day, with several stocks hitting the daily limit [4] - Key stocks included Ruimaotong, Tianshun Co., Feilida, and Changlian Co. [4] 2. Consumer Sector - The consumer sector maintained its strong performance, with leading stocks such as Guofang Group, Zhongyuan Home, and Bei Yin Mei advancing [7] - The People's Daily emphasized the need for extraordinary measures to boost domestic consumption [8] 3. Gold Sector - The gold sector experienced a surge, with stocks like Sichuan Gold, Hengxing Technology, and Western Gold hitting the daily limit [9] - The spot gold price surpassed $3130 per ounce [18] 4. Consumer Electronics and Robotics - The consumer electronics and robotics sectors, which had previously seen declines, began to recover, with many stocks hitting the daily limit, although they experienced a pullback overall [11] - Tesla's stock rose by 22% overnight, positively impacting related sectors [12] 5. Investment Outlook - Analysts predict that the Belt and Road strategy will become increasingly important amid escalating US-China trade tensions, with a projected 5.16% growth in trade with Belt and Road countries in 2024 [6] - The robotics industry is expected to transition from formation to expansion, with significant investment opportunities anticipated by 2025 [14]
